Enhancing Efficiency Through Blockchain and AI
One of the most significant advantages of combining blockchain and AI is the enhancement of operational efficiency. Blockchain's immutable and transparent nature ensures that data is tamper-proof and easily verifiable, reducing the need for intermediaries and manual verification processes. AI, on the other hand, can automate complex tasks, optimize workflows, and provide real-time insights.
For instance, in supply chain management, blockchain can track the movement of goods from origin to destination, ensuring transparency and traceability. AI algorithms can analyze this data to predict delays, optimize routes, and reduce costs. This synergy not only streamlines operations but also builds trust among stakeholders.
In the financial sector, blockchain-based systems can facilitate faster and more secure transactions, while AI can detect fraudulent activities and manage risk more effectively. Smart contracts, self-executing contracts with the terms directly written into code, can automate and enforce agreements, reducing the need for legal interventions and speeding up processes.
Boosting Security with Blockchain and AI
Security is a paramount concern in the digital age, and the combination of blockchain and AI offers robust solutions to protect sensitive data and prevent cyber threats. Blockchain's decentralized nature makes it inherently resistant to single points of failure and cyber attacks. AI enhances this security by continuously monitoring networks for anomalies and potential threats.
AI-powered security systems can detect and respond to threats in real-time, adapting to new attack patterns and vulnerabilities. This proactive approach is crucial in an environment where cyber threats are becoming increasingly sophisticated. Additionally, blockchain can secure data storage and transmission, ensuring that sensitive information remains confidential and intact.
A notable example is the use of blockchain in identity verification and management. By storing identity data on a blockchain, individuals gain control over their personal information, and AI can verify identities quickly and securely, reducing the risk of identity theft and fraud.
Innovating with Blockchain and AI
The convergence of blockchain and AI is not only about efficiency and security but also about fostering innovation across various industries. From healthcare to manufacturing, the potential applications are vast and varied.
In healthcare, blockchain can secure patient data and ensure compliance with regulations like HIPAA, while AI can analyze medical records to provide personalized treatment recommendations. This combination can lead to more accurate diagnoses, better patient outcomes, and more efficient healthcare delivery.
In the realm of finance, blockchain and AI can revolutionize trading and investment strategies. Blockchain provides a transparent and secure platform for trading assets, while AI can analyze market trends, predict price movements, and execute trades with minimal human intervention. This synergy can democratize access to financial markets and enhance investment decision-making.
The entertainment industry is another area where blockchain and AI can drive innovation. Blockchain can ensure fair compensation for content creators by tracking and verifying ownership and usage rights. AI can personalize content recommendations, enhancing user engagement and satisfaction.
